Personalized Image Aesthetic Assessment via Preference-rich Sample Mining and Cohort Merging

个性化图像审美评估(PIAA)旨在预测个体差异化的图像审美评分。审美偏好在不同视觉刺激中表现程度各异,并呈现群体特异性模式。为此,本文提出一种基于多模态大语言模型(MLLM)的方法——偏好丰富样本挖掘与美学共鸣群体融合(PRAC)。PRAC首先通过分析图像的集体争议性与个人偏离度,识别出偏好丰富的样本,最大化有限用户数据的利用效率;随后基于偏好嵌入比较跨用户偏好相似性,构建美学共鸣用户群体;最后采用群体模型融合策略,聚合共鸣用户的偏好模式,进一步提升目标个体的个性化表现。在四个基准PIAA数据集上的大量实验表明,所提PRAC模型优于现有最先进方法。代码与模型将公开于https://github.com/yzc-ippl/PRAC。

Personalized Image Aesthetic Assessment (PIAA) aims to predict aesthetic ratings of images that vary across individuals. The aesthetic preferences manifest to different extents across distinct visual stimuli and exhibit cohort-specific patterns. Motivated by the above fact, this paper presents a Multimodal Large Language Model (MLLM)-based approach, which models individual aesthetic preferences by Preference-Rich sample mining and Aesthetically-resonant Cohort merging (PRAC). Specifically, PRAC first identifies preference-rich samples by analyzing both Collective Controversy and Personalized Deviation of images, maximizing the utility of limited user data. Based upon the preference-rich samples, cross-user preference similarities are measured by comparing preference embeddings. Then, a cohort-based model merging strategy, is proposed by aggregating preference patterns from aesthetically-resonant users, which further enhances the personalization for the target individual. Extensive experiments and comparisons on four benchmark PIAA databases demonstrate the superiority of the proposed PRAC model over the state-of-the-arts. The code and model will be public at https://github.com/yzc-ippl/PRAC.
